32位微型计算机原理与接口技术(第3章.pdf
上传人:qw****27 上传时间:2024-09-12 格式:PDF 页数:30 大小:179KB 金币:15 举报 版权申诉
预览加载中,请您耐心等待几秒...

32位微型计算机原理与接口技术(第3章.pdf

32位微型计算机原理与接口技术(第3章.pdf

预览

免费试读已结束,剩余 20 页请下载文档后查看

15 金币

下载此文档

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

32位微型计算机原理与接口技术第3章微处理器结构计算机应用教研室/实验中心计算机系楼407/4135890282/5892120(办)3-1第3章80486微处理器„预备知识„Intel微处理器发展概述„第一代微处理器„Intel4004、Intel4040—4位微处理器„Intel8008—低档8位微处理器„第二代微处理器„Intel8080、MC6800、6501、6502—8位微处理器„Intel8085、Z80、MC6809—高档8位微处理器„指令比较完善,有了中断与DMA„汇编、BASIC,FORTRAN、PL/M„后期配备CP/M操作系统2005.2.15淮海工学院计算机系陈书谦3-2Intel微处理器发展概述„第三代微处理器„Intel8086、Z8000、MC68000—16位„-8086数据总线16位、地址总线20位„Intel8088—准16位„-外部数据总线8位,内部数据总线16位-IBMPC、IBMPC/XT„Intel80286、MC68010—高档16位„-数据总线16位,地址总线24位„-IBMPC/AT„-实地址模式、虚地址保护模式„-虚地址模式可寻址16MB物理地址和1GB的虚拟地址空间2005.2.15淮海工学院计算机系陈书谦3-3Intel微处理器发展概述„第四代微处理器„Intel80386—32位微处理器-数据总线32位,地址总线32位„-实地址模式、虚地址保护模式、虚拟8086模式3246„-虚地址模式可寻址4GB(2)物理地址和64TB(2)的虚拟地址空间„Intel80486—32位微处理器-80386+80387+8KB的Cache„-部分采用RISC技术、突发总线技术„-使用时钟倍频技术2005.2.15淮海工学院计算机系陈书谦3-4Intel微处理器发展概述„第五代微处理器„Pentium(奔腾)—32位微处理器-5级超标量结构、分支预测技术-64条数据线、32条地址线-常用指令硬件化,使用微程序设计„PentiumMMX(多能奔腾)—32位-增加了57条MMX指令-采用了SIMD技术„第六代微处理器(P6核心结构)„PentiumPro(高能奔腾)—32位-64条数据线、36条地址线-实现了动态执行技术(乱序执行)„PentiumII(奔腾2)—32位微处理器-是PentiumPro+MMX-双独立总线结构•PentiumIII(奔腾3)—32位微处理器-增加了70条SSE指令-首次内置序列号2005.2.15淮海工学院计算机系陈书谦3-5Intel微处理器发展概述„Pentium4—32位微处理器(非P6核心结构)-NetBurst结构-超级管道技术-增加了144条SSE2指令-简单ALU运行在2倍的处理器核心频率下„Itanium—64位微处理器-采用EPIC技术、RISC技术和CISC技术-具有显示并行功能-具有断定执行功能-具有数据预装的功能-采用三级高速缓存2005.2.15淮海工学院计算机系陈书谦3-68086/8088处理器内部结构„第一代微处理器16位微处理器„相同:内部数据总线16位地址线20位寻址空间220=1M采用DIP40引线封装单相时钟+5V电源„区别:外部数据总线8086为16位8088为8位引脚定义28、34脚指令队列8086为6字节8088为4字节故;8088为准16位微处理器,8086为标准16位微处理器2005.2.15淮海工学院计算机系陈书谦3-7地Vcc(5V)地Vcc(5V)AD14AD15A14A15AD13A16/S3A13A16/S3AD12A17/S4A128A17/S48A18/S5AD11A18/S5A1100A19/S6A10A19/S6AD108AD98BHE/S7A9SS0(HIGH)AD86MN/MXA88MN/MXAD7RDAD7RDAD6HOLD(RQ/GT0)AD6HOLD(RQ/GT0)AD5HLDA(RQ/GT1)AD5HLDA(RQ/GT1)AD4WR(LOCK)AD4WR(LOCK)AD3M/IO(S2)AD3M/IO(S2)AD2DT/R(S1)AD2DT/R(S1)AD1DEN(S0)AD1DEN(S0)AD0ALE(QS0)AD0ALE(QS0)NMIINTA(QS1)NMIINTA(QS1)INTRTESTINTRTESTREADYCLKREADY